Licensing and Regulatory Bodies
Licensing is a cornerstone of the legal landscape for casinos. Regulatory bodies are tasked with ensuring that casinos operate within the bounds of the law, maintaining a fair and safe gaming environment. These agencies assess applications for licenses, conduct regular audits, and monitor compliance with gambling regulations. Failure to adhere to these standards can result in severe penalties, including the revocation of a casino's license.
The licensing process often involves extensive background checks on owners and operators to prevent criminal activity and ensure that individuals in leadership positions are fit to manage a gambling establishment. This helps to maintain the integrity of the gaming industry and build trust among players.
Responsible Gambling Practices
Responsible gambling practices are an essential component of the legal landscape surrounding casinos. Many jurisdictions require casinos to implement measures that promote safe gaming habits among players. This includes offering self-exclusion programs, providing information about responsible gambling, and establishing limits on betting amounts.
By fostering a responsible gambling culture, casinos contribute to reducing the risks of addiction and ensuring that gaming remains a form of entertainment rather than a harmful activity. Legal frameworks often mandate these practices, making them a critical aspect of casino operations worldwide.
Online Gambling Regulations
The rise of online casinos has introduced new legal challenges and opportunities. Laws governing online gambling can differ significantly from those for brick-and-mortar establishments. Some countries have embraced online gaming, establishing clear regulatory frameworks, while others impose strict bans or operate in a legal gray area.
As the online casino market continues to expand, operators must navigate a complex web of international laws, which may include data protection regulations, taxation requirements, and consumer rights protections. Staying compliant with these laws is vital for online casinos to operate legally and successfully in the competitive digital space.
